Yes, an axe is an example of a third-class lever, where the effort is between the fulcrum and the load. When using an axe, the handle acts as the lever arm with the hand providing the force, the pivot point at the head of the axe serving as the fulcrum, and the cutting edge as the load.
The axe is a type of simple machine known as a wedge. The sharp edge of the axe concentrates force to split wood or other materials when it is struck.

When holding an axe, always keep a firm grip on the handle, wear protective gloves, and make sure the blade is sharp and secure. Keep the axe away from your body and others, and never swing it in a crowded or confined space. Always be aware of your surroundings and never leave the axe unattended.
